Google rolls out Drive shortcuts ahead of folder structure changes
The tech giant is rolling out the feature ahead of changing Drive’s folder structure. Starting on September 30th, all your files will live in a single location — it will no longer be possible to place a file in multiple folders, in case you have quite a few that are meant to be accessed by different people. After the change takes place, the files that live in multiple folders will gradually become shortcuts. Finally, to make the transition easier, Google is replacing the “Add to My Drive” button’s function, so that tapping it will add a shortcut to Drive instead.
